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(232, 81%, 46%) | color: hsl(232, 81%, 46%) | |
| HEX | #1630D4 | color: #1630D4 | |
| RGB | rgb(22, 48, 212) | color: rgb(22, 48, 212)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(90%, 77%, 0%, 17%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(232, 90%, 83%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(232 8% 17%) | color: hwb(232 8% 17%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.435 0.2442 266.04) | color: oklch(0.435 0.2442 266.04) | |
| Lab | lab(31.89 52.95 -84.03) | color: lab(31.89 52.95 -84.03) | |
| LCH | lch(31.89 99.32 302.22) | color: lch(31.89 99.32 302.22) |

What colors go well with #1630D4?
The complementary color is HSL(52, 81%, 46%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 232°, 352°, and 112°. For analogous combinations, try hues 202° and 262°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
